Onions are definitely useful. It contains vitamin C, fiber and antioxidants. These plants can help boost your immune system and improve digestion. Onions can also reduce the risk of chronic diseases.

Curry, in turn, can be healthy if use the right ingredients. Spices in curry powder such as turmeric and ginger really good for health. Turmeric contains curcumin, which may have anti-inflammatory effects. Ginger can help digestion.

Onions

Onions have a positive effect on health. However, keep in mind that every body is different. Some people are sensitive to onions and experience stomach problems or heartburn. Therefore, if you notice any intolerances, it is recommended to reduce the consumption of onions.

“Onions are rich in vitamin C, which boosts the immune system. This means that the vegetable can help your body better protect itself from colds and other infections. The antioxidants in onions lower cholesterol levels and the risk of heart disease. They can also help regulate blood pressure,” she says. therapist Irina Andreeva especially for Medikforum.

Anti-inflammatory:Some compounds in onions have anti-inflammatory effects. This can help reduce inflammation in the body and minimize related health problems.

Blood sugar regulation: Onions also contain compounds that can stabilize blood sugar levels. This is especially beneficial for people with diabetes or those who want to monitor their sugar levels.

Digestion: The fiber in onions is good for digestion. They support your gut health, prevent constipation, and support healthy intestinal flora.

Antioxidants:Onions are also rich in antioxidants. They fight free radicals in the body that cause cell damage. It can reduce the risk of chronic diseases such as cancer.

Curry

“How your curry dish is healthy depending on how you prepare it.If you use a lot of butter, cream and fatty ingredients, it can be quite high in calories. Instead, try to include more vegetables and lean proteins like chicken or tofu. This provides you with important nutrients. Homemade curry is often better because you can control the ingredients.”

Curry powder is not a single ingredient, but a mixture of various spices that are often used in Indian cuisine.These include cumin, turmeric,coriander, ginger, cardamom and many others. These spices are added not only for taste, but also for health.

But typical Curry is not only made of spices – curry dishes also contain vegetables, legumes, meat or fish. Vegetables provide vitamins, minerals and fiber needed for a balanced diet.
